Understanding Static Site Generators

Hugo serves as one of the leading static site generators, transforming raw data and predesigned templates into efficient, static HTML documents. These static site generators, including Hugo, offer significant advantages in web development by simplifying backend necessities and boosting security by eliminating the need for server-side processing. Unlike dynamic sites, which constantly query databases to generate pages on the fly, static sites offer considerable speed enhancements. This is made possible because webpages are pre-generated, allowing users to access content almost instantaneously. Additionally, the static nature of these sites inherently reduces security vulnerabilities, as there are no server-side scripts to exploit.

Hosting static sites built with Hugo presents minimal requirements compared to their dynamic counterparts. With no need for a database or server-side language support, static sites can be deployed on any web server. This makes them cost-efficient and less complex to maintain. This also offers flexibility in hosting options, from traditional servers to modern cloud-based solutions, further enhancing their scalability and reliability for diverse web applications.

The role of templating systems in static site generation is pivotal. Hugo utilizes powerful templating to create consistent site layouts, ensuring a cohesive and uniform user experience. This templating system allows developers to separate content from design, providing a seamless way to update the appearance of a website without altering its core content. The Go Template Language

Hugo stands as a prominent tool for crafting static websites, leveraging the power of the Go template language to offer efficiency and extensibility in web design. Go templates, embedded within Hugo, transform the development process into one marked by simplicity and adaptability. The Go language’s straightforward syntax enables developers to create reusable components, streamlining site construction. For example, using partials—reusable snippets of code—you can significantly reduce repetitive elements in your site’s design, making updates uniform and less time-consuming.

The use of variables in Hugo’s Go templates allows users to control site behavior intricately. Variables can range from simple data types to complex structures. They can be used for defining everything from site-wide configurations to page-specific settings. Through well-defined variables, developers can ensure that their sites are not just aesthetically pleasing but functionally efficient as well.

Moreover, Hugo’s templating facilitates dynamic elements within the otherwise static paradigm, enhancing user engagement. By implementing conditional logic and loops, developers can introduce features like blogs with paginated content or automatically generated navigation menus. These elements, while static in essence, provide a dynamic user experience, adapting seamlessly according to user interaction.

Content Management in Hugo

Hugo offers a powerful and intuitive framework for efficient content management, especially following the dynamic aspects of the Go Template Language explored earlier. With Hugo, organizing your content is straightforward, operating primarily through Markdown files and a logical directory structure. By adhering to a clear hierarchy, you can segment your site’s content into sections, posts, and pages, making navigation and updates simpler and more effective. The use of Markdown allows for clean and readable text files that can be easily edited and versioned.

Central to Hugo’s content management is the front matter, a specific segment at the beginning of each content file. The front matter plays a crucial role by defining page variables such as titles, dates, tags, and custom parameters essential for content classification and retrieval. This not only enhances flexibility but also empowers users to customize the content presentation without much hassle.

For those concerned about content versioning and backup, Hugo seamlessly integrates with version control systems like Git. This integration provides robust content versioning, ensuring that changes can be tracked and previous versions can be retrieved if needed. It also facilitates collaborations by allowing multiple users to work on the same static site projects concurrently with minimal conflicts.

SEO Optimization with Hugo

Hugo, recognized for its speed and flexibility, offers powerful SEO-friendly features that can significantly boost your site’s visibility. Static sites, by design, deliver faster load times—a crucial factor in search engine rankings. Leveraging Hugo can enhance these benefits with tailored SEO tactics that fit static sites.

The foundation of SEO in Hugo begins with understanding meta tags and crafting SEO-friendly URL structures. Hugo allows you to easily define meta tags such as title and description, which help search engines comprehend the content and purpose of your page. These tags can be managed within your theme’s template setup, allowing for consistent SEO optimization across your entire site.

Setting up SEO-friendly URLs in Hugo is both straightforward and impactful. Clean, human-readable URLs enhance user experience and SEO ranking. Hugo enables you to configure these URLs through its file structure and front matter configurations, ensuring that your site remains both organized and accessible for crawlers.

Beyond its native capabilities, Hugo’s ecosystem supports various tools and plugins designed to fortify your site’s SEO. Integrating with Sitemaps and utilizing plugins that generate AMP (Accelerated Mobile Pages) can further boost your site’s reach and loading performance on mobile devices.

Deploying Hugo Sites

Hugo simplifies the process of deploying static sites, making it an attractive platform for IT professionals and tech enthusiasts looking to maximize the performance of their digital infrastructure. After optimizing for search engines, the next logical step is to ensure your Hugo site is easily accessible to your audience. Numerous hosting platforms seamlessly integrate with Hugo, allowing for flexible deployment options tailored to your specific needs and technical environment.

An exceptional choice for instant deployment is Netlify, where Hugo sites can be hosted effortlessly. Netlify automates the build and deployment processes, enabling you to push your Hugo site live with just a few clicks. This integration reduces the complexity often associated with deployment and ensures your site is delivered quickly to users.

Incorporating automation into your deployment strategy further enhances efficiency. By leveraging Continuous Integration/Continuous Deployment (CI/CD) pipelines, you can automate updates to your Hugo site. This means any changes committed to the source repository can be automatically deployed without manual intervention, ensuring that your site remains current and secure.

Scaling Static Sites with Hugo

Hugo stands out as an exceptional tool for building dynamic static sites due to its innate scalability. By capitalizing on Hugo’s static nature, developers can achieve remarkable scalability and performance. Understanding the role of Content Delivery Networks (CDNs) is crucial. CDNs are networks of servers distributed across various geographical regions. They work by caching and serving static site content from the server closest to a user’s location, which significantly reduces load times and improves site performance. This global reach enables your Hugo site to scale effortlessly, ensuring quick access and a seamless user experience globally.

Strategies for scaling your Hugo site without compromising performance include optimizing images and scripts, which reduces file size and accelerates load times. Implementing a versioning system for assets also helps, allowing browsers to cache resources efficiently, diminishing the need to reload them on every visit. Moreover, a minimalist design with essential features ensures the site remains lightweight and fast.

Hugo’s capability to manage high-traffic sites is evidenced by several noteworthy examples in the industry. Many content-heavy sites employ Hugo to handle significant traffic volumes, thanks to its quick build times and efficient performance. The static site nature of Hugo, combined with CDN support, effectively sustains high-traffic demands without degradation in speed or reliability.
